The Ford F-150 Throttle Cable stands as an essential part that demonstrates the well-known reliability and performance standards of Ford vehicles. Utility as the physical connection between the acceleration pedal and throttle plate allows operators to manage engine airflow efficiently while maintaining safety levels. The F-150 models from previous generations applied direct throttle control through this cable but Ford switched to Electronic Throttle Control (ETC) for their current models due to their commitment to modern technological integration. This durable braided metal component installs as the main part of the Throttle Cable mechanism in many F-150 models to provide dependable service. The wide compatibility with many F-150 generations solidifies its essential role in keeping the vehicle's operation systems intact. The Throttle Cable continues to support the famous Ford F-150 durability reputation that has existed for more than 70 consecutive years. Ford F-150 Throttle Cable Parts and Q&A

  • Q: How to service and repair the throttle cable and linkage on Ford F-150?
    A:
    Service and repair operations on the throttle cable and linkage start with disconnecting the Accelerator Cable from its position on the accelerator pedal and shaft. Release the accelerator cable lock tabs present inside the passenger compartment to pull the cable into the engine bay before cable removal. Starting with a forward rotation of the throttle lever allows you to remove the throttle lever end of the accelerator cable. A second depression of the accelerator cable lock tabs enables you to pull out the accelerator cable from its bracket. Follow the opposite steps used for removal to install the component.
